Default Re: Congrats Rick Pike, first '56 in the 10's

that is a 265 plus 10.6 inches[assume .080 over] plus whatever you could get by with on the crank. so 276 inches maybe. 8 to 1 flat tops, 1.75 x 1.5 valves, and as richard says two carbs with butterflys the size of nickles! all that and either a 2 speed powerglide or a three speed manual
when someone tells you they had a friend who had a '57 that really ran....just laugh and nod.
many years ago i got my '56 Nomad with a 265 to run 13.15 at vegas [2200' 12.85 corrected] and though i had really done something
